The Razer Barracuda X is a versatile wireless gaming headset designed for PC, PlayStation, Switch, and mobile devices. It stands out with its SmartSwitch feature, letting you switch easily between 2.4GHz wireless for gaming and Bluetooth for phones, which is great if you want one headset for both gaming and daily calls. With 40mm TriForce drivers, it delivers clear, balanced sound—so game audio feels rich and immersive without distortion. The detachable HyperClear cardioid mic is tuned to reduce background noise, making your voice clear during multiplayer chats, and you can remove it for a cleaner look or portability.

Comfort is a strong point here: the lightweight 250g design, breathable memory foam ear cushions, and swiveling earcups make it comfortable for long gaming sessions or commuting. Battery life is impressive too, lasting up to 50 hours on a single charge with quick Type-C charging, so you won’t need to recharge often. In terms of compatibility, it covers a broad range of devices including PC, consoles, and smartphones, making it flexible for different setups. The on-headset controls add convenience for adjusting volume and managing calls without reaching for your device.

On the downside, the headset isn’t water resistant, so it’s not ideal for sweaty workouts or wet environments. Also, while its plastic build is sturdy, it might not feel as premium or rugged as some higher-end models. The sound isolation is decent but might let some outside noise in during very loud surroundings. If you want a lightweight, multi-device wireless headset with solid sound and mic quality for gaming and everyday use, the Barracuda X offers great value. It is especially good for gamers who switch between devices and need long battery life combined with comfort. However, if you prioritize ultra-durable materials or advanced noise cancellation, you might want to consider other options.

Buying Guide for the Best razer gaming headset

Choosing the right gaming headset can significantly enhance your gaming experience. A good headset can provide immersive sound, clear communication with teammates, and comfort for long gaming sessions. When selecting a gaming headset, consider the following key specifications to ensure you get the best fit for your needs.
Sound QualitySound quality is crucial for a gaming headset as it affects how well you can hear in-game sounds, such as footsteps, gunfire, and environmental cues. Look for headsets with high-quality drivers that offer clear and balanced sound. Headsets with surround sound capabilities can provide a more immersive experience by simulating a 360-degree audio environment. If you play competitive games, prioritize headsets with precise sound localization to help you detect the direction of sounds accurately.
Microphone QualityA good microphone is essential for clear communication with your teammates. Look for headsets with noise-canceling microphones that can filter out background noise, ensuring your voice comes through clearly. Some headsets offer detachable or retractable microphones, which can be convenient if you don't always need to use the mic. If you frequently play multiplayer games, prioritize headsets with high-quality microphones to enhance your team coordination.
ComfortComfort is important, especially for long gaming sessions. Look for headsets with adjustable headbands, cushioned ear cups, and lightweight designs. Materials like memory foam and breathable fabric can enhance comfort. If you wear glasses, consider headsets with ear cups designed to accommodate them. Try to find a headset that fits well and doesn't cause discomfort after extended use.
ConnectivityGaming headsets can be wired or wireless. Wired headsets typically offer more stable connections and lower latency, which is important for competitive gaming. Wireless headsets provide more freedom of movement but may require charging and can sometimes have latency issues. Consider your gaming setup and preferences when choosing between wired and wireless options. If you prefer convenience and mobility, a wireless headset might be the better choice.
CompatibilityEnsure the headset is compatible with your gaming platform, whether it's PC, console, or mobile. Some headsets are designed to work with multiple platforms, while others may be specific to one. Check the compatibility specifications to avoid any issues. If you switch between different gaming devices, look for a versatile headset that can easily connect to all your devices.
DurabilityDurability is important to ensure your headset lasts through intense gaming sessions and frequent use. Look for headsets made with high-quality materials and sturdy construction. Features like reinforced cables and metal frames can enhance durability. If you travel with your headset or use it frequently, prioritize models known for their robust build quality.
Additional FeaturesSome gaming headsets come with additional features like customizable RGB lighting, built-in audio controls, or software for sound customization. These features can enhance your gaming experience and allow for personalization. Consider which additional features are important to you and how they can improve your overall gaming setup.
